A plugin package containing one add-on called review-as. It studies a GitHub user's past code-review comments and uses that style when reviewing changes in chat.

In plain words
What is it for?
Use it to review a change as a selected GitHub user, based on up to a year of their review comments.
Why use it?
It helps produce reviews that match a particular reviewer's known preferences without posting anything to GitHub.

mainframe-skills scanned grade A with 0 findings against 26 rules in 11 categories — prompt injection, anti-refusal, data exfiltration, privilege escalation, supply chain, agent snooping, system-prompt leakage, SSRF and excessive agency — measured yesterday.

A static scan of the body, not an audit. Every finding is printed with the line that produced it so you can judge whether it matters here. A mod is markdown that instructs an agent; that is exactly why what it instructs is worth reading.

Nothing flagged

None of the 26 patterns this scan looks for appear in this file: no shell pipes, no recursive deletes, no credential paths, no hidden text, no instruction-override or anti-refusal phrasing, no agent-config snooping. That is not a guarantee, it is the absence of the things that are checkable.
